Conference of the States Parties to the United Nations Convention against Corruption

On December 15-19 in Doha, Qatar, International Whistleblower Advocates (IWA) will be participating as a civil society group in the 11th Conference of the State Parties (CoSP 11) to the United Nations Convention Against Corruption (UNCAC).

As an approved NGO “observer” for the Convention, IWA is working with a network of anti-corruption organizations, agencies, and human rights defenders to support the introduction of an urgent resolution supporting the implementation of critically needed whistleblower/anti-corruption practices to combat transnational crimes such as bribery and money laundering.

Enforcement of laws such as the Foreign Corrupt Practices Act and Anti-Money Laundering protections are at a critical crossroads, and the need for increased enforcement should be high on the Convention’s agenda. With diminishing U.S. leadership on the fight against international corruption, it’s more crucial than ever for liberal democracies to take the lead in rolling out an effective international anti-corruption regime. CoSP 11 is an important stage for working towards this “Reverse Marshall Plan.”

    Stephen M Kohn - International Whistleblower Attorney

    Stephen M. Kohn

    International Whistleblower Attorney

    In addition to winning the first-ever $100 million whistleblower award (UBS Swiss Banker Bradley Birkenfeld), Kohn has set numerous precedents expanding the scope of protections for whistleblowers and securing multi-million dollar judgments under the False Claim, Dodd-Frank, tax, and environmental whistleblower laws. Kohn helped write key whistleblower laws, including Dodd-Frank and Sarbanes-Oxley. He has pioneered transnational whistleblower protections under the FCPA and Commodity Exchange Act and was the principal author of the Anti-Money Laundering Whistleblower Enhancement Act. In 1985 he wrote the first-ever legal treatise on whistleblower law. His 8th book on whistleblower law is Rules for Whistleblowers (Lyons Press 2023).
